Washington State SMART President Pleads Guilty

On April 7, Pascale McAtee, former president of International Association of Sheet Metal, Air, Rail and Transportation Workers (SMART) Local 161, Transportation Division, pleaded guilty in U.S. District Court for the Western District of Washington to one count of embezzling more than $82,000 in funds from the Everett (Snohomish County), Wash.-based union. He had been indicted last December. Sentencing is scheduled for July. The actions follow a probe by the U.S. Labor Department’s Office of Labor-Management Standards.
